How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Patch?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| Patch Studio Apartments | $849 | $849 | $849 |
Patch 1 Bedroom Apartments | $949 | $675 | $2,710 |
| Patch 2 Bedroom Apartments | $1,160 | $750 | $1,700 |
| Patch 3 Bedroom Apartments | $1,145 | $1,145 | $1,145 |

Frequently Asked Questions about 1 Bedroom Patch Apartments
How much is the average rent for a 1 Bedroom Patch Apartment?
The average rent for a 1 Bedroom Apartment in Patch is $949.
What is the largest available 1 Bedroom Patch Apartment for rent?
Today's apartment with the most square footage in Patch is a 1,085 square feet unit starting from $1,100 at Lyon School Apartments.
